1. Prepare
Observe performance or review work product
Determine if previous commitments were attempted, completed, and how. Decide strengths and opportunities. Capture behavioral and contextual details.
2. Connect & Establish Goal of the Conversation
Greet and initiate
Demonstrate interest, help them relax. Set the conversation’s purpose.
3. Discuss Reality (3 Parts)
- Strengths or Progress
- Transitions
- Corrective or Constructive Opportunities
4. Consider Options & Plan
Ask for possible solutions
Going forward, how might you handle that differently?
Ask how to implement solutions
How do you think you can make that change / implement that?
5. Commit to the Way Forward
Ask for verbal agreement
Will you try that/do that/work on that next time?
Ask for written agreement
Ask they write out WHAT they are doing, HOW, and by WHEN
6. Follow-Through
Coach Commitment
What and When you will do to support their commitment
Log & Track
Track your and their commitments for what you will each do and when
